I am making this post in order to clearly demonstrate the changes to my narrative. I have rewritten parts of the screenplay in accordance with how much I think I will need to cut down or cut out completely.
The changes I have made are outlined below:
- Instead of using the same monologue for the voiceover, I decided to rewrite it in order to keep is more impersonal and less emotionally involved. This is because if it was actually Dylan speaking, then the words would've been both emotionally engaging as well as explanative, but using just audio instead of visuals removes some of the engagement that the viewer can connect with.
- I have also removed the spoken interaction between the Father and the Son about the hearing. I feel as though this seems a little forced and just more of an excuse to expand on the backstory, and although I want to show them talking whilst they walk, I don't necessarily want it to be reflective of the current storyline. Therefore I decided that it would be better if the characters just spoke naturally and realistically about whatever comes to mind.
- Without the scene with Dylan laying the flowers at the start, the audience will have to infer in the final scene that the first bouquet has been laid by him. I think that this could work quiet nicely in terms of ambiguity and subtext, allowing viewers to speculate for themselves.
